   Johnson rd. (Lappin's farm) west end near Stow/Summit cty border, flooded 
nicely with the latest storms and overnight a flock of short billed dowitchers 
(100+) were present this evening along with dunlin, greater yellowlegs and other 
waders I couldn't ID in the fading light. I will be checking in the morn and 
will try to update any interesting  newcomers. Beautiful plumage. If there was a 
long billed in the bunch it escaped me.
